Obituary

Donald Joseph "Don" Bushey, age 72, of Jonesboro, Georgia, passed away peacefully in his home on September 25, 2025 surrounded by his entire family. Born on November 1, 1952, in Kansas City, Kansas, to the late William and Lillian Bushey, Don grew up in Mission, KS, attending St. Pius X, Bishop Miege High School, and the University of Kansas. He earned his private pilot license in 1973 from Johnson County Community College, beginning a lifelong career in aviation. By 1974, Don had become a commercial pilot and was soon flying with Lawrence Aviation before earning his flight engineer rating in 1978. In March 1979, he was hired by Delta Air Lines, where he moved his family to Atlanta and rose through the ranks to become Captain in January 1992. After retiring in 2004 as a 757/767 Captain, Don continued to fly with Cargo 360, piloting 747s between Anchorage, Alaska, and Incheon, South Korea, from 2005 to 2007. He then returned to Delta Global Services as a highly respected 757/767 Flight Instructor, a role he held until his passing. In addition to his professional accomplishments, Don's greatest joy was his family. He met the love of his life, Susan, in January 1974, and the two were married in January 1976 at Queen of the Holy Rosary in Overland Park, Kansas. Together they built a beautiful life filled with love, laughter, and adventure. Don was a devoted husband, father, papa, and brother, known for his quiet strength and unwavering dedication to those he loved. Don was a man of many talents—an exceptional cook who delighted in preparing meals for his family, a skilled woodworker, and a true "Camaro man." He loved being outdoors, whether working in the yard or traveling the world with Susan. Their most recent trip to Alaska, shared with family, was a life-changing experience he treasured deeply. A faithful and active member of St. Philip Benizi Catholic Church in Jonesboro, Don's life was rooted in his faith and his love for community.
